write any two differences between lyophilic and lyophobic colloids .

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

Lyphilic colloids
(i) solvent liking
(ii) reversible solution
(iii) Quite stable
(iv) Cannot be easily co-agulated
Ex: Gelatin, starch
Lyphobic colloids
(i) solvent hating
(ii) Irreversible solutions
(iii) Less stable
(iv) can be coagulated easily by adding small amount of electroyt, Ex Gold sol, silver sol.
